I had the comic of Ninja Turtles and it was more serious and gritty in tone. The turtles were mental killers as in true ninjas without all the colour coding, it was an adult comic so lots of decapitations and no cheesy stuff like the kids show. Even the Splinter/Shredder stuff was awesome, really laying into each other with real hatred. They will never make it though.
